AI Summary

  • Repeals multiple state advisory bodies and councils, including the Environmental Advisory Council, Jekyll Island Citizens Resource Council, Georgia Palliative Care and Quality of Life Advisory Council, Board of Homeland Security, Employment First Georgia Council, Georgia State Games Commission, and Lottery Retailer Advisory Board, with assets and liabilities transferring to the State of Georgia on July 1, 2025.

  • Abolishes the Georgia Volunteer Fire Service Council and consolidates its functions under the Georgia Firefighter Standards and Training Council, which will now oversee certification and training requirements for all firefighters including volunteers.

  • Expands the State Housing Trust Fund for the Homeless Commission from 9 to 11 members, with the Governor appointing 5 public members (increased from 3) and the President of the Senate and Speaker of the House each appointing 2 members, with new terms beginning August 23, 2025.

  • Removes references to the Governor's Office for Children and Families throughout the Georgia Code and transfers its functions related to mentoring programs to the Department of Human Services.

  • Transfers Employment First Policy advisory duties from the repealed Employment First Georgia Council to the Georgia Vocational Rehabilitation Services Board, which will continue developing training plans and making biannual recommendations on policies supporting competitive integrated employment for individuals with disabilities.
